1.5伏电源安装调试
首先我们来完成最基本,最必须的电源部分安装调试,任何电路都离不开电源部分,单片机系统也不例外,而且我们应该高度重视电源部分,不能因为电源部分电路比较简单而有所忽略,其实有将近一半的故障或制作失败都和电源有关,电源部分做好才能保证电路的正常工作。
AT89C51实验开发板提供了一个9伏400毫安的外接交流电源,它能空载输出12伏的直流电压,如果有的网友不需要我们提供的稳压电源,需要自己配的话,可以选择输出直流电压为10~15伏之间电源,并且插头极性为内正外负的电源,切记!稳压电源输出的直流电压通过专门的电源插座把直流电压引入实验开发板,左边两个是12伏的电源滤波电容,一般大电容旁边并联一个小电容的目的是降低高频内阻,因为大的电解电容一般采用卷绕工艺制造,所以等效电感较大,小电容可以提供一个小内阻的高频通道,降低电源全频带内阻,这个在实际电路中非常常见哦~
首先我们从套件中找出要用到的元件,如下图:
电源部分兵分两路,一路直接提供12伏的直流电源,主要是提供给继电器使用的,另一路通过三端稳压芯片7805稳压成5伏直流电源提供给单片机系统使用,右边两个电容是5伏电源的滤波电容,电阻和绿色的LED组成5伏电源的工作指示电路,只要电源部分正常,绿色的LED1就会点亮,我们可以根据这个LED来判断整个电源部分是否工作正常,电源部分就是下面图像中需要安装的元件。
菜鸟注意事项:
1。有极性的电解电容正负不要颠反,引脚长的哪个为正极
2。三端稳压7805不要装反,可以参照图片位置依葫芦画瓢~~
3。LED极性不要颠反,引脚长的哪个为正极
最后请用万用表测量+12V和+5V输出是否正常。
2.AT89C51单片机最小化系统安装测试
我们从套件中找出要用到的元件,如下图:
单片机的最小化系统是指单片机能正常工作所必须的外围元件,主要可以分成时钟电路和复位电路,我们采用的是AT89C51芯片,它内部自带4K的FLASH程序存储器,一般情况下,这4K的存储空间足够我们使用,所以我们将AT89C51芯片的第31脚固定接高电平(PCB画板时已经接死),所以我们只用芯片内部的4K程序存储器。单片机的时钟电路有一个12M的晶振和两个30P的小电容组成,它们决定了单片机的工作时间精度为1微秒。复位电路由22UF的电容和1K的电阻及IN4148二极管组成,以前教科书上常推荐用10UF电容和10K电阻组成复位电路,这里我们根据实际经验选用22UF的电容和1K的电阻,其好处是在满足单片机可靠复位的前提下降低了复位引脚的对地阻抗,可以显著增强单片机复位电路的抗干扰能力。二极管的作用是起快速泄放电容电量的功能,满足短时间多次复位都能成功。
判断单片机芯片及时钟系统是否正常工作有一个简单的办法,就是用万用表测量单片机晶振引脚(18、19脚)的对地电压,以正常工作的单片机用数字万用表测量为例:18脚对地约2.24V,19脚对地约2.09V。对于怀疑是复位电路故障而不能正常工作的单片机也可以采用模拟复位的方法来判断,单片机正常工作时第9脚对地电压为零,可以用导线短时间和+5V连接一下,模拟一下上电复位,如果单片机能正常工作了,说明这个复位电路有问题
关键字:单片机 电源 安装调试
引用地址:
单片机电源及基本部分的安装调试
推荐阅读最新更新时间:2024-03-16 13:52
高效学习AVR单片机的方法
怎样可以成为单片机高手,下面是一些建议学习的流程。 一、购买一两本书,笔者推荐两本 《单片机 C语言开发入门指导》,《高档8位单片机ATmega128原理与开发应用指南》。买书的目的:看书大体了解单片机的结构和工作原理,了解基本概念和基础知识,其实新手是不可能完全看懂一本书的,如果你能,你已经是高手了,所以不要期望一字一句去搞懂书上说的到底是什么东西。看完书对相关内容有个概念性的了解就可以了。 二、开始动手配置开发环境,动手去做,实践出真知。笔者推荐使用ICC AVR + AVR studio +AVR mega16 + JTAG&ISP下载仿真器的组合。抄几个程序,增强一下自己的信心,看到自己的程序在单片机上跑起来,那种愉悦
[单片机]
基于单片机的自动温度测量报警系统设计
摘要:目前,在自动控制领域用温度作为一种控制量对系统进行自动控制已经越来越普遍。针对这种实际情况本文设计了一种简单实用的温度报警系统。该系统以AT89C51单片机为中央处理单元,大大降低了系统开发的成本。通过温度传感器LM35采集外部的温度,并将温度转换成相应的电压值。A/D转换装置对电压值进行模数转换,将结果送入中央处理单元进行计算。单片机根据其处理的结果决定是否需要启动报警装置。结果表明,该系统可以在5~150℃环境下工作,当外界的温度达到设定的报警温度时该系统能够及时地做出反应,具有一定的现实价值。 关键词:AT89C51;传感器;A/D转换;自动报警 目前,无论是在工业生产中还是在科研实验中通过对温度测量来进行自动控制
[单片机]
基于AVR单片机的24C08数据操作的C语言程序设计
#include iom16v.h #include macros.h #define uint unsigned int #define uchar unsigned char #include I2C_drive.h //包含I2C总线驱动程序软件包 uchar const seg_data ={0xC0,0xF9,0xA4,0xB0,0x99,0x92,0x82,0xF8,0x80,0x90,0xff}; //0~9和熄灭符的段码表 uchar const bit_tab ={0xbf,0x7f}; //第7、8只数码管位选表 uchar disp_buf ={0,0}; //定义2个显示缓冲单元 uchar val;
[单片机]
单片机AT89C51--1.前期准备
本文所需要的资料都存放于网盘中,如有需要,自行下载。 链接: https://pan.baidu.com/s/1eAvlj3hTU9971qYIp4f8XA 提取码: 1zpk 1.Win10系统驱动安装 安装驱动的原因: 通俗的话来说,就像鼠标,看上去好像插上去就能用,其实淘宝店买的话都可以发现上面介绍里写着免驱等介绍,都需要靠驱动才能让笔记本控制鼠标,或者单片机,和他们之间通信,这属于硬件间的驱动,当然还有软件间的,说白了就是为了传输数据。 找一根安卓线,一边USB接口一边安卓接口,连接笔记本和单片机。 1.1 自动安装驱动 若电脑出现自动安装界面,且打开计算机,管理,设备管理器的端口选项出现了CH34
[单片机]
MCS-51系列单片机的引脚中有多少根I/O线?
问题:. MCS-51系列单片机的引脚中有多少根I/O线?它们与单片机对外的地址总线和数据总线之间有什么关系?其地址总线和数据总线各有多少位?对外可寻址的地址空间有多大? 解答:80C51单片机有4个I/O端口,每个端口都是8位双向口,共占32根引脚。每个端口都包括一个锁存器(即专用寄存器P0~P3)、一个输入驱动器和输入缓冲器。通常把4个端口称为P0~P3。在无片外扩展的存储器的系统中,这4个端口的每一位都可以作为双向通用I/O端口使用。在具有片外扩展存储器的系统中,P2口作为高8位地址线,P0口分时作为低8位地址线和双向数据总线。
[单片机]
为您解析远程电源管理带来的好处
电源插座也能远程管理了,不知大家是否听说过这样的电源插座。说起电源插座想必大家都很了解,它是我们日常生活中不可缺少的用电设备,在它的身上担负着及大安全责任。但是可以进行远程管理的电源插座,或许是第一次听说。 网络 电源 控制器为什么会如此受们的青睐。下面笔者将为您来解读网络电源控制器(PowerBox系列产品)究竟可以带给我们怎样的好处。我们以网络机房来举例。 好处一:突破传统的人工重启方式 传统的人工重启往往是等到服务器、交换机等用电设备出现了故障,不能正常供电,才由值班人员去查找故障所在,并进行简单的手动重启。这样势必耗费很多宝贵的时间,而且很多场合也是不允许的。频繁进出机房进行人工重启,不仅对机房恒温恒湿的环境造成破坏
[电源管理]
超详细的单片机交通信号灯控制程序
利用定时器计时,注释非常详细,可自己改变定时时间。 单片机源程序如下: #include reg52.h #define GPIO_TRAFFIC P2 #define GPIO_DIG P0 typedef unsigned char u8; typedef unsigned int u16; //3-8译码器引脚位定义 sbit LSA = P1^0; sbit LSB = P1^1; sbit LSC = P1^2; //交通信号灯南北方向控制引脚位定义 sbit GREEN10 = P2^0; sbit RED10 = P2^1; sbit GREEN11 = P2^2; sbit YELLOW11 = P2^3
[单片机]
POLA DC/DC模块电源砖电路设计剖析
POLA 模块电源 板级电源设计的成熟度和可靠度直接影响着电子产品的稳定性。在设计复杂的板级DC/DC时,为了减小设计风险,提高设计成熟度,加快开发一次成功率,越来越多的方案引入了DC/DC电源模块。目前主流的DC/DC模块电源生产商主要分为DOSA联盟和POLA联盟两大阵营。 POLA模块是非开放标准的设计,所以要深入分析电路有一定难度。但是考虑到POLA模块电源的电路设计基本相同,所以笔者以PTH03030 POLA模块电路为例,对其电路设计进行了深度剖析。 PTH03030模块电源总体架构分析 PTH03030模块电源是一种非隔离的POLA电源,可输出30A电流,模块面积大约9cm2,采用PCB多层板设计,可以满足目
[电源管理]